How many MDS's do you have total, and how are they assigned? 'ceph fs status'.
On Mon, Mar 9, 2020 at 3:14 PM Peter Eisch <[email protected]> wrote: > Hi, (nautilus, 14.2.8, whole cluster) > > I doodled with adding a second cephfs and the project got canceled. I > removed the unused cephfs with "ceph fs rm dream --yes-i-really-mean-it" > and that worked as expected. I have a lingering health warning though which > won't clear. > > The original cephfs1 volume exists and is healthy: > > [root@cephmon-03]# ceph fs ls > name: cephfs1, metadata pool: stp.cephfs_metadata, data pools: > [stp.cephfs_data ] > [root@cephmon-03]# ceph mds stat > cephfs1:3 > {0=cephmon-03=up:active,1=cephmon-02=up:active,2=cephmon-01=up:active} > [root@cephmon-03]# ceph health detail > HEALTH_WARN insufficient standby MDS daemons available > MDS_INSUFFICIENT_STANDBY insufficient standby MDS daemons available > have 0; want 1 more > [root@cephmon-03]# > > I have not yet deleted the pools for 'dream', the second cephfs > definition.
